Tsebo Facilities Solutions is looking for a Contracts Coordinator to support the Contract Manager by coordinating procurement, financial administration, and contract-related activities. The role ensures compliance with company policies and service level agreements while supporting efficient facilities management service delivery aligned to the contract objectives.

Responsibilities

Procurement & Supplier Coordination

  • Source quotations from suppliers and prepare recommendations
  • Raise purchase orders and coordinate ordering processes
  • Maintain effective relationships with suppliers and service providers
  • Ensure all purchases are supported by approved quotations
  • Monitor supplier compliance with agreed terms and conditions

Delivery & Asset Coordination

  • Coordinate delivery, installation, and internal distribution of goods Inspect deliveries and ensure quality standards are met
  • Resolve delivery or quality issues with suppliers
  • Maintain accurate records (manuals, warranties, documentation)
  • Support asset registration and tagging processes

Financial Administration

  • Process invoicing in line with client agreements and timelines
  • Track and monitor orders daily to ensure completion
  • Ensure correct allocation of costs to divisions and cost centres
  • Support variance reporting and budget tracking (CAPEX and OPEX)
  • Ensure adherence to financial controls, approval limits, and cut-off dates

Contract & Compliance Support

  • Ensure compliance with procurement policies, procedures, and SLAs
  • Maintain a transparent and accurate financial tracking process
  • Monitor spend against budget and highlight risks
  • Support implementation of SHEQ and quality management systems
  • Ensure alignment with company and client contractual requirements

Customer & Stakeholder Engagement

  • Respond to client queries and provide timely resolutions
  • Build strong working relationships with internal and external stakeholders
  • Support client satisfaction initiatives and surveys
  • Maintain a customer-focused approach to service delivery

Reporting

  • Prepare and submit monthly reports within agreed timelines
  • Provide accurate data for client and internal reporting requirements    

 

Qualifications

  • Grade 12 (Matric) – essential
  • Bookkeeping or Accounting qualification (or equivalent)
  • Minimum 3 years’ experience in a similar role/environment

Personal Qualities & Competencies

  • MS Office Suite (Excel, Word, Outlook)
  • Knowledge of INFOR EAM or similar systems
  • Understanding of supply chain and procurement processes
  • Budgeting and financial administration
  • Knowledge of service level agreements (SLAs)
  • Report writing and data analysis
  • Contract and vendor management
